Why is Christ's view of us important for our assurance?

Answered in 1 source

Christ's view of us is central to our assurance because it is His perception of our righteousness and beauty that truly defines our standing before God.

The security of a believer is anchored in how Jesus views them rather than their personal feelings or perceptions. The sermon illustrates that believers may see themselves as unworthy, but Christ, our husband, sees His bride as beautiful and without blemish. In moments of doubt or struggle with sin, reflecting on how Christ sees us provides comfort and reassurance. It emphasizes that it is His assessment that counts, and if He deems us worthy through His righteousness, we can rest assured in our salvation and acceptance.
Scripture References: Song of Solomon 4:7, 1 John 3:1
